什么是Github Clone加速器?它的工作原理是什么?
Github Clone加速器是一种优化工具,旨在提升仓库克隆和拉取速度,减少等待时间。 它通过网络技术手段,改善用户与GitHub服务器之间的数据传输效率,特别适合在中国大陆等地区,由于网络限制导致访问速度缓慢的问题。为了理解其工作原理,首先需要了解GitHub的基本数据传输流程。每当你在本地使用git clone或git pull命令时,实际上是在请求GitHub的服务器传输仓库数据。这个过程受到网络带宽、地理位置和网络环境的影响,可能出现延迟或中断,尤其是在国际链路较差时尤为明显。Github加速器的核心目标是通过优化这些环节,提升数据传输的稳定性和速度。
其工作原理主要依赖于以下几个技术手段:首先,利用CDN(内容分发网络)技术,将GitHub仓库的缓存节点部署在更接近用户的地区,减少数据传输距离,降低延迟。其次,通过搭建代理服务器或VPN,绕过地区网络限制,确保数据畅通无阻。许多加速器还采用智能路由算法,自动选择最快、最稳定的线路,为用户提供最优的连接路径。此外,一些加速器会对传输数据进行压缩,减少数据包大小,从而提升传输效率。所有这些方法共同作用,显著改善了在中国大陆访问GitHub仓库的速度。
具体来说,当你启用GitHub加速器后,实际上是将你的git请求重定向到加速器提供的中转节点。这些节点通常拥有高速宽带连接和优化的网络架构,能快速响应你的请求,将仓库数据传输到你的本地环境。与此同时,加速器还会持续监测网络状况,动态调整路由策略,确保连接的稳定性和高效性。这样一来,你在克隆、拉取、推送代码时,不仅节省了大量时间,也大大降低了因网络不佳而导致的中断风险。值得一提的是,选择合适的Github加速器,不仅可以提升工作效率,还能确保在复杂网络环境下的开发体验更加顺畅。若你希望深入了解不同加速器的技术细节,可以参考相关的网络优化技术资料或专业社区的讨论。
使用Github Clone加速器有哪些好处?
使用Github Clone加速器能显著提升代码克隆速度,减少等待时间,优化开发效率。在日常开发中,尤其是在访问国外仓库或大规模项目时,网络延迟和带宽限制常常成为瓶颈。Github加速器通过优化网络路径、专用节点和智能路由,有效降低了数据传输的延迟,使得代码同步、克隆和拉取操作变得更加迅速和稳定。这不仅节省了宝贵的开发时间,也提高了团队协作的效率,避免因网络问题而影响项目进度。根据2023年GitHub官方数据,使用加速器后,克隆速度平均提升了30%以上,特别是在访问海外仓库时效果更为明显。
此外,Github Clone加速器还能确保数据传输的安全性。许多优质的加速器都配备了加密协议,保障你的代码和敏感信息在传输过程中不会被窃取或篡改。这对于企业和敏感项目尤为重要。值得一提的是,一些加速器还支持多平台同步,方便你在不同设备间无缝切换,提升工作连贯性。通过合理选择和配置Github加速器,你可以实现更稳定、更快速的代码管理体验,特别是在面对复杂网络环境或国际合作时,显得尤为关键。
不仅如此,使用Github Clone加速器还能帮助你规避一些网络限制和屏蔽问题。在部分地区,Github访问可能受到限制或速度极慢,影响开发效率。借助加速器,你可以绕过这些限制,确保无缝访问所需仓库资源。这对于远程团队、跨国合作或海外开发者来说,具有极大的实用价值。许多专业用户反馈,通过使用加速器后,团队沟通与协作变得更加顺畅,项目推进也更加高效。结合行业内的口碑和用户体验,选择合适的Github加速器成为提升开发效率的重要一环。
目前推荐的Github Clone加速器有哪些?它们各自的特点是什么?
目前市面上常用的Github Clone加速器主要有多款,它们各自凭借不同的技术优势满足不同用户的需求。这些加速器通过优化网络连接、提供高速节点或结合CDN技术,有效减少克隆仓库时的等待时间,提升开发效率。根据最新的行业调研,以下几款是目前较为推荐的Github加速器,它们在速度、稳定性和易用性方面表现优异,值得广大开发者尝试使用。
第一个值得关注的加速器是“FastGit”。它通过建立遍布全球的高速节点网络,提供稳定的加速服务,支持多平台使用。FastGit的最大优势在于其免费且无需复杂配置,用户只需切换Git的远程地址到FastGit提供的镜像站点即可实现快速克隆。根据2023年GitHub用户反馈,FastGit在访问速度和稳定性方面表现优异,特别适合中国大陆用户。其官方网站(https://fastgit.org/)提供了详细的配置指南,帮助用户快速上手。值得注意的是,FastGit不断优化节点布局,确保在高峰期也能维持良好的连接速度,增强了整体的使用体验。
第二款推荐的Github加速器是“CNPM”。它是由国内开发者维护的镜像平台,拥有丰富的GitHub仓库镜像资源。CNPM的亮点在于其镜像库的及时更新和对多种协议的支持,如SSH和HTTPS,确保用户在不同环境下都能顺畅操作。CNPM不仅支持仓库镜像,还提供了便捷的命令行工具,极大简化了仓库同步流程。根据2022年的行业报告,CNPM在国内的访问速度平均提升了40%以上,特别适合企业级开发团队使用。其官方网站(https://cnpmjs.org/)提供了详细的使用文档,帮助用户快速配置和应用。
第三个值得提及的是“GitClone Speed”。它采用智能路由技术,自动选择最快的网络路径,为用户提供极致的克隆体验。该加速器的特点在于其深度优化的算法,可以在不同网络环境下实现自适应加速。根据多项用户测试,GitClone Speed在国际访问时表现尤为出色,特别适合需要频繁跨国访问仓库的开发者。它的界面简洁,操作直观,支持多平台使用,受到广大技术人员的好评。官网(https://gitclonespeed.com/)提供了详细的速度测试结果和配置教程,帮助用户轻松实现极速克隆。
如何选择适合自己的Github Clone加速器?有哪些使用技巧?
选择适合自己的Github Clone加速器需要考虑多个因素,确保能够提升下载速度、稳定性和安全性。 在挑选过程中,你应关注加速器的性能、兼容性以及服务质量,以便更高效地进行代码同步和仓库管理。通过科学的筛选,能显著改善你的开发体验,提升工作效率。
首先,性能是衡量一个Github加速器的重要标准。你可以通过查阅第三方评测报告或用户反馈,了解不同加速器在不同地区的速度表现。例如,Some CDN提供商在全球多个节点部署,能够有效降低延迟,提升下载速度。建议选择拥有广泛节点覆盖的加速器,确保在你所在地区也能获得良好的连接体验。
其次,兼容性和支持的功能也值得重视。确保所选加速器支持常用的Git客户端和操作系统,如Windows、macOS和Linux。部分加速器还提供专门的插件或命令行工具,简化配置过程。你可以参考官方文档或社区评价,确认其功能是否满足你的实际需求,避免后续使用中出现兼容性问题。
此外,服务的稳定性和安全性也是关键因素。优质的Github加速器应提供稳定的连接和持续的技术支持,避免频繁掉线或延迟飙升。安全性方面,建议选择提供加密传输、数据保护措施的服务商,确保你的代码和账号信息不被泄露。可以参考一些专业安全评测或用户口碑,选择信誉良好的品牌。
在实际使用中,掌握一些技巧也能提升加速效果。例如,合理设置DNS,提高域名解析速度;使用本地镜像站点,减少跨国传输;合理配置Git的缓存和连接参数,优化数据传输过程。逐步调试和优化配置,有助于达成最佳的加速效果,确保开发流程流畅无阻。
最后,建议你可以加入相关的技术社区或论坛,获取最新的加速器推荐和使用经验。像GitHub社区、知乎、CSDN等平台上,许多开发者会分享他们的实践经验和实用技巧,帮助你做出更明智的选择。通过不断试用和调整,找到最适合自己项目和环境的加速方案,才能真正发挥Github加速器的最大优势。
Github Clone加速器的使用常见问题及解决方案有哪些?
使用Github clone加速器时常见的问题主要集中在连接不稳定、速度缓慢和配置困难等方面。 这些问题影响开发效率,但大部分可以通过合理的排查与调整得到解决。理解常见问题的根源,有助于你更高效地使用Github加速器,确保代码同步的顺畅与安全。本文将详细介绍几种常见问题及其对应的解决方案,帮助你在实际操作中游刃有余。
连接不稳定是使用Github加速器时遇到的最普遍问题之一。可能因网络环境变化、VPN设置不当或加速器服务器负载过重引起。为改善连接稳定性,建议你首先确认网络环境是否良好,避免在网络繁忙时段进行操作。其次,选择离你物理位置较近的加速器节点,能有效减少延迟。同时,确保VPN或代理设置正确,避免配置错误导致的连接中断。若问题持续,可以尝试切换不同的加速器节点,或者重启设备和软件,排查是否为软件冲突或缓存问题所致。依据权威网络测试机构的数据显示,合理选择节点能提升连接稳定性达30%以上。
速度缓慢也是许多用户关心的问题。通常由带宽限制、服务器负载或配置不当引起。为提升速度,建议你优先选择信誉良好、服务稳定的Github加速器提供商,例如“Shadowrocket”或“Clash”,它们在行业中具有较高的评价。此外,确保你的网络带宽充足,避免同时进行大量下载或观看高清视频。可以尝试调整加速器的连接协议或端口设置,使用更高效的传输协议如V2Ray或Trojan,有助于提升整体速度。根据2023年的行业报告,优化协议和节点选择能使加速效果提升达40%以上。
配置困难也是许多用户面临的挑战,尤其是不熟悉代理工具或缺乏技术背景的用户。为简化操作流程,建议你选择界面友好、操作直观的加速器软件或插件。此外,参考专业的配置指南或官方教程,逐步进行设置可以避免错误。通常,配置步骤包括:选择节点、设置代理协议、导入配置文件等。你可以访问一些权威技术社区或官方文档,例如GitHub官方文档和“V2Ray”社区,获取详细指导。实践中,我曾经通过逐步按照教程操作,成功在10分钟内完成了配置,极大提升了工作效率。确保每一步操作都按照指南执行,能有效避免常见的配置错误。
常见问题解答
什么是Github Clone加速器?
Github Clone加速器是一种优化工具,旨在提升仓库克隆和拉取速度,减少等待时间,改善用户与GitHub服务器之间的数据传输效率。
使用Github Clone加速器有哪些好处?
它可以显著提升代码克隆速度,减少等待时间,确保数据传输安全,并帮助绕过网络限制,提升开发效率和体验。
Github Clone加速器如何工作?
它通过部署CDN节点、使用代理或VPN、智能路由和数据压缩等技术手段,优化数据传输路径,提升速度和稳定性。